Overview
Precision Cutting for Everyday Tasks
The Westcott E-84000 00 Snap Knife is a practical tool for office, warehouse, or craft projects. Its durable plastic handle and 9mm blade provide accurate cutting performance, while the snap-off feature keeps your blade sharp and ready to use.
Specifications:- Blade Size: 9mm
- Handle Material: Plastic
- Handle Color: Blue
- Blade Feature: Break-off device in cap
- Application: Office, warehouse, and craft work
- Blade Length: 5.9 cm
- Housing: Lightweight Plastic

Pros & Cons
👍 Pros
- Features a lightweight plastic housing, making it easy to handle and carry during various tasks.
- Suitable for easy cutting work, indicating it is designed for straightforward and less strenuous cutting needs.
- Ideal for use in office environments, warehouses, and for craft work, highlighting its versatility across different settings.
- The snap-off blade design allows for quick and simple access to a fresh, sharp edge when the tip dulls.
👎 Cons
- The blade is non-lockable, which might pose a safety concern for users who prefer a fixed blade during use.
- The lightweight plastic housing, while convenient, may not offer the same durability as models with metal construction for heavy-duty tasks.
- With a blade length of 5.9 cm, it is designed for lighter cutting tasks and may not be suitable for larger or thicker materials.
- The product description highlights its suitability for "easy cutting work," implying limitations for more demanding or robust applications.
